Let's make an impact together.Perspecta is an AA/EEO Employer - Minorities/Women/Veterans/Disabled and other protected categories Responsibilities Provides support to the customer's Enterprise Architecture Office and supports the acquisition, configuration, integration, testing and implementation of a future Enterprise Architecture toolset for the Intelligence Community using the NoMagic COTS solution platform. Responsibilities also include working with vendor on tool integration and enhancements as well as implementation and deployment within customer classified environments. A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or a related discipline and at least 7 years of software engineering experience. Four years of additional SWE experience may be substituted for a bachelor's degree.Individuals in this position must have the following:Experience designing, coding, testing and supporting next-generation database solutions. Experience providing integration, implementation and maintenance of COTS/OSS products/tools.Proficiency in an assortment of technologies, including Linux and Windows servers and languages JavaScript, Java, Ruby, Jython, Groovy.Ability to apply systems engineering principles to current and future designs. Ability to create and implement software engineering requirements into various environments. Ability to modify, write, and implement code to incorporate within COTS packages (ex: Java, JavaScript, Angular JS). Ability to debug, problem solve and analyze code (ex: Java, JavaScript, Angular JS). Experience designing, developing, testing and implementing software and architecture within the customer environment. Ability to modify, write, and implement custom reports. Ability to assist with the design of software applications. Ability to analyze and improve the efficiency, scalability, and reliability of applications.Requires active TS/SCI with Polygraph Clearance.Individual Capabilities Desired:Excellent oral and written communications skills.Experience with our Maryland customer.
